Abstract
The invention discloses a dracaena sanderiana soilless culture nutrient formula comprising the components in parts by weight: 13-18 parts of diisopropanolamine, 10-12.5 parts of ammonium ferric sulfate, 2-20 parts of salicylic acid, 4-5 parts of tryptophan, 4-5 parts of threonine, 0.4-0.6 part of palladium nitrate, 0.1-0.3 part of barium hydroxide, 0.1-0.3 part of iodine pentoxide, 0.08-0.2 part of calcium gluconate, and the balance water; the nutrient formula is obtained by weighing the components according to the proportion and mixing evenly; with the use of the nutrient solution, the osmotic force and diffusivity of the nutrient solution are increased greatly during seedling culture, and thus the seedling emergence period is greatly shortened, the seedling emergence rate and the quality of emergence seedlings are improved, and besides, the cost is reduced; and the nutrient solution is more suitable for high-altitude low-temperature seedling culture.
